Vous êtes sur la page 1sur 2

Assigment:

Cu 1. Ti sao bn la chn h thng CSDL thay v lu d liu trong file qun l bi h iu


hnh? Khi no bn khng nn dng h CSDL?
Khng la chn lu tr d liu trong file qun l bi h iu hnh v cc l do sau:
D tha d liu v tnh khng nht qun
Kh khn trong vic truy xut d liu
S c lp d liu
Cc vn v tnh nguyn t
Vn an ton: mt ngi s dng h c s d liu khng cn thit v cng
khng c quyn truy xut tt c cc d liu
Khi m cn qun l mt d liu vi quy m nh th khng nn dung h CSDL bi v n
s rt tn km.
Cu 2. c lp d liu mc logic (Logical data independence) l g? Ti sao n quan trng?
Trong qu trnh khai thc CSDL ngi ta c th nhn thy tnh cn thit phi sa i
lc khi nim nh b sung thm thng tin hoc xa bt cc thng tin ca cc thc th ang
tn ti trong CSDL. Vic thay i lc khi nim khng lm nh hng ti cc lc con,
do khng cn phi vit li cc chng trnh ng dng. Tnh cht c lp ny c gi l tnh
c lp ca d liu mc lgic (Logical Independence).
Cu 3. Gii thch s khc nhau gia c lp d liu mc logic v c lp d liu mc vt l
(physical data independence)? Hy cho v d minh ha.
Cu 4. Gii thch s khc bit gia lc nim/logic (conceptual/logical schema), lc
vt l/bn trong (Physical/internal schema) v lc ngoi (external schema).
Cu 5. Trch nhim ca DBA. Gi s l DBA khng cn quan tm n vic thc hin cc cu
truy vn ca chnh DBA, th DBA c cn hiu v ti u ha cu truy vn khng? Ti sao?
Cu 6. ng A cn mua mt h CSDL. tit kim chi ph, ng A ch mua mt h CSDL vi s
tnh nng t nht c th. ng ta lp k hoch ch chy n mt mnh trn my PC ca ng y v
khng share thng tin vi ai c. Hy cho bit tnh nng no trong cc tnh nng di y ca
DBMS ng A mua nn c v ti sao:
+ Tin ch bo mt
+ Kim sot ng thi
+ Khi phc d liu sau s c
+ C ch khung nhn
+ Ngn ng truy vn
Cu 7. M t cu trc ca mt DBMS. Gi s h iu hnh ca bn c nng cp h tr
thm mt s chc nng v file (v d kh nng cho php lu mt chui cc bytes ln a). Hy
cho bit lp no ca DBMS bn cn phi vit li c th tn dng u im ca cc tnh nng
mi .
Cu 8. Tr li cc cu hi sau:
1. Giao tc (transaction) l g?
2. Ti sao mt DBMS thc hin xen k cc hnh ng ca cc giao dch khc nhau thay v
thc hin ln lt tng giao dch mt ?
3. Mt user phi chc chn iu g m bo tnh nht qun gia mt giao dch v
CSDL ? Mt DBMS nn chc chn iu g m bo tnh nht qun gia thc hin
ng thi nhiu giao dch v CSDL.
4. Gii thch v nghi thc kha 2 giai on nghim ngt (the strict two-phase locking
protocol).
5. Tnh cht WAL l g v ti sao n quan trng ?

Vous aimerez peut-être aussi